Scarriff’s Rugby Coach says they set out their stall to be competitive at home upon returning to the Munster Junior League.

The club returned to Division Three of the provincial competitions and have taken time to settle after picking up just one win in their first seven games.

They face Kerry’s Corca Dhuibne on Sunday and Gearoid Devanny hopes that with a few games under their belt, they’re now getting the hang of this division.
